The Appeal of Goyard

Goyard is not just a brand; it's a legacy that dates back to 1853. Its bags are revered for their craftsmanship, quality, and timeless design. Unlike other luxury brands that rely heavily on marketing, Goyard maintains an air of mystery, rarely advertising and letting its products speak for themselves. The signature chevron pattern, painted meticulously by artisans, makes each piece unique.

But what truly makes Goyard bags desirable? It's their exclusivity. With limited availability and a prestigious clientele, owning a Goyard bag is a status symbol. Celebrities and fashion icons alike covet these bags for their understated luxury. Yet, the price point ensures that they remain out of reach for many, fueling the desire to own one, even if it means resorting to replicas.

The Risks of Buying Fake Designer Bags

Purchasing counterfeit designer bags might seem like a savvy way to enjoy luxury without breaking the bank, but it comes with significant pitfalls. Legally, buying and selling fake goods violate intellectual property laws, potentially leading to fines or legal action. Ethically, it supports an illicit industry that exploits workers and undermines authentic brands.

Quality is another concern. Fake designer bags often lack the durability and craftsmanship of the originals. They are prone to wear and tear, leading to a false economy where buyers end up spending more on replacements. There's also the social stigma attached; being exposed with a fake can be embarrassing and damage one's reputation.

How to Spot Fake Goyard Bags

For those determined to buy a Goyard bag, understanding how to authenticate one is crucial. Look for telltale signs like uneven stitching, incorrect logo fonts, and poor-quality hardware. Authentic Goyard bags feature a unique serial number and are made from a special coated canvas that feels distinct to the touch.

Another vital tip is to purchase from reputable stores or directly from Goyard boutiques. If buying online, insist on detailed photographs and verify the seller's authenticity. Experts recommend comparing potential purchases with known authentic items, paying close attention to even the smallest details.

Alternatives to Buying Fake Designer Bags

Admiring designer bags doesn't have to mean compromising on ethics. There are several legitimate alternatives to consider. For example, purchasing pre-owned bags from trusted retailers can offer a more affordable entry into luxury fashion. Brands like Fashionphile and The RealReal authenticate items before sale, providing peace of mind.

Another option is exploring emerging designers who offer quality craftsmanship without the designer price tag. These brands can offer unique styles that stand out in a sea of mainstream designs. Supporting them not only satisfies the desire for luxury but also encourages innovation within the fashion industry.
